Medical transcription: Steps for easy transition to outsourced services


The role of medical transcription in both the operational and commercial aspects of healthcare is undeniable. Outsourcing medical transcription has been found to be an easy, economical, efficient and effective to the process of medical records creation. However the process of choosing the right medical transcription service provider needs a certain process so that it can result in a fruitful and long-term association.
The steps leading to successful outsourcing of medical transcription are:
Defining the purpose of outsourcing medical transcription: This part of the outsourcing process is very important and often overlooked. Overlooking this step in the process of outsourcing can result in:
1.                             Unrealistic expectations: Outsourcing medical transcription can help the healthcare facility in many aspects. But focusing only on factors like reduced cost and ignoring quality can result in outsourcing expectations not being met.
2.                             Inadequate customization: Healthcare professionals of different specialties may have specific requirements. These may not be included while customizing services if the purpose of outsourcing is not clearly defined
3.                             Loss of productivity: Not defining the purpose of outsourcing medical transcription can result in certain tasks being overlooked and resulting in loss of productivity
Consulting the people involved in or affected by outsourcing medical transcription: Outsourcing medical transcription affects personnel of several departments of the healthcare facility. It is important to involve all the people in the process of outsourcing to ensure success. It is important to not only consult the healthcare professionals and support staff, but is also vital to include the inputs of the Information technology, administrative, management and finance departments to gain maximum from outsourcing medical transcription
 Defining the desired outcome from outsourcing medical transcription:
1.                             Reducing cost of medical transcription
2.                             Accuracy levels
3.                             Desired turnaround time
4.                             Formals/templates/fonts
5.                             Document delivery modes
6.                             HIPAA/HITECH compliant transcription
7.                             Adoption of EMR/EHR
Designating key people for implementation: Transition for outsourced medical transcription services can require some adjustments. To ensure smooth transition it is important to designate key people who can coordinate with the medical transcription service provider staff to ensure seamless transition.
Starting the process of outsourcing: To actually start the process of outsourcing medical transcription it is important to undertake the following steps:
1.                              Technology adjustment
2.                             Familiarizing healthcare professionals and support staff with uploading dictation and downloading finished transcripts
3.                             Establishing open channels of communication with the medical transcription service provider.
Outsourcing medical transcription is an important decision and following the due process can result in satisfactory outcome for all the parties concerned.
